The Weald of Kent, Surrey and Sussex
1881 Brasted, Kent Census
That part of Brasted that includes Brasted Hill Farm and Brasted Village
Please note:
  • These census records have been transcribed from images of the original census sheets. Whilst all care has been taken, the result is an interpretation of the original which is available at Local Record Offices, from The National Archives, and from ancestry.co.uk
  • Occupation has been unified (e.g. Ag Lab, Farm Lab, and many other such recordings are all displayed as Farm labourer).
  • The Sheet Number is as shown on the original document and is linked to a page showing all the entries on that Sheet (as well as entries from the following or previous sheet where the entry for the location covers more than one sheet).
  • In those instances where the Census entry is incorrect or missing and it has been possible from other sources to derive a correction, then these changes are shown inside square brackets, e.g. [Wife]

Sheet    Place    Census entry

20[Brasted]Richard Burnett, M, Head, married, age 25, born Ide Hill, Kent, occupation: carpenter
    Mary Burnett, F, Wife, married, age 25, born Brasted, Kent
    Ethel Burnett, F, Daughter, age 2, born Brasted, Kent
    Catherine Burnett, F, Visitor, age 4, born Brasted, Kent, occupation: scholar
    Alice Inkpen, F, Servant, age 13, born Brasted, Kent; occupation: domestic servant
    Albert Cooling, M, Lodger, single, age 22, born Tetbury, Suffolk; occupation: painter

20[Brasted]George Wells, M, Head, married, age 41, born Brasted, Kent, employs 12 men; occupation Builder
    Amy S. Wells, F, Wife, married, age 35, born Sevenoaks, Kent; occupation Fancy Repository (Gos Text)
    Amy B. Wells, F, Daughter, age 14, born Brasted, Kent; occupation Scholar
    Lillian M. Wells, F, Daughter, age 10, born Brasted, Kent; occupation Scholar
    George S. Wells, M, Son, age 8, born Brasted, Kent; occupation Scholar
    Richard L. Wells, M, Son, age 6, born Brasted, Kent; occupation Scholar
    Jesse P. Wells, F, Daughter, age 5, born Brasted, Kent; occupation Scholar
    Agnes L. Wells, F, Daughter, age 3, born Brasted, Kent
    Eleanor M. Wells, F, Daughter, age 2, born Brasted, Kent

20[Brasted]John Osmar, M, Head, married, age 53, born Brasted, Kent; occupation Retired Innkeeper
    Sarah Osmar, F, Wife, married, age 48, born Westerham, Kent
    Mary Osmar, F, Daughter, single, age 19, born Brasted, Kent
    Joseph Osmar, M, Son, age 14, born Brasted, Kent; occupation Scholar

20[Brasted]Charles West, M, Head, widowed, age 64, born Brasted, Kent; occupation Baker

20Bull InnRichard Berry, M, Head, married, age 27, born Rotherfield, Sussex; occupation: innkeeper
    Fanny Jeal, F, Visitor, age 10, born Oxted, Surrey
    Sarah Berry, F, Head, married, age 24, born Oxted, Surrey
    William R. Berry, M, Son, age 10 m, born Brasted, Kent

20[Brasted]William Simmons, M, Head, married, age 45, born Portsmouth, Hampshire; occupation: farm labourer
    Elizabeth Simmons, F, Wife, married, age 50, born Warwick, Warwick
    Mary A. Simmons, F, Daughter, age 10, born Tillon, Leicester
    David Fuller, M, Lodger, single, age 60, born Chatham, Kent; occupation: farm labourer
    John Richards, M, Lodger, single, age 58, born Taunton, Somerset; occupation Farm labourer
    Sydney Deacon, M, Lodger, single, age 30, born Bath, Somerset; occupation: farm labourer
